PURPOSE AND SCOPE:
Provides nutritional services for the facility’s in-center and home patients as applicable in order to maximize the patient’s nutritional status and improve clinical outcomes. Functions as a member of the interdisciplinary healthcare team, supporting the FMCNA commitment to the Quality Enhancement Program (QEP) and Quality Assessment and Performance Improvement (QAI) activities. Actively participates in process improvement activities that enhance the likelihood that patients will achieve their individualized patient-specific goals as determined by the patient’s physician.

CKD -CKD-ND Nutrition Services
In specified markets will support the Chronic Kidney Disease non dialysis (CKDND) initiatives such as:
The role will spend part of the time providing individual and group Medical Nutrition Therapy (MNT) counseling to CKD-ND patients using multiple platforms: telephonically, visual video platform or in person at approved locations upon program leadership request where member privacy can be ensured.
CKD and ESRD duties need to be segregated and not performed in the same location.
Must have applicable state licensure.
